Abstract
The present application provides a method and a process for strengthened leaching of laterite nickel ore. The method comprises: obtaining reaction conditions for a laterite nickel ore leaching reaction; establishing a reaction model for the laterite nickel ore leaching reaction based on the reaction conditions; wherein the reaction model comprises a liquid-layer diffusion control model, a product-layer diffusion control model and a reaction control model; determining a reaction conversion yield of the laterite nickel ore leaching reaction based on the reaction model; the applicable reaction models under different reaction conditions are established based on the reaction temperature, acid/ore ratio, and reaction period, and thereby the laterite nickel ore leaching process can be controlled accurately. The present application provides theoretical basis and guidance to the strengthened leaching of laterite nickel ore, and thusly improving the reaction rate of the laterite nickel ore leaching reaction.
